Portrait Of A Party.
This photo is hot! Share it!
I sat back and thought about the lighting that's usually available at parties and one thing that stood out was flashes from other small cameras. Cameras and Flashes are a natural part of parties, so what would a portrait of a party be without such a crucial ingredient. The flash in this photo is actually the other camera's flash caught by mine.
